Definitions
- the present invention relates to a badminton shuttlecock and its manufacturing process.
- Such a flywheel comprises a plug, from which extends a skirt formed by different feathers, connected to each other.
- a flywheel comprises a plug, from which extends a skirt formed by different feathers, connected to each other.
- two main types of wheels are known.
- a first type of flying is formed of entirely natural feathers, taken from poultry, such as geese.
- This solution has a disadvantage in that the production of natural feather flounces requires the use of an extremely large number of animals. Under these conditions, this production may be jeopardized in the case of a poultry shortage. Moreover, the cost price of these wheels is particularly high.
- a second type of flywheel uses an artificial skirt, made in one piece of a synthetic material, such as polypropylene. Although this solution solves the problem of cost and animal shortage, it does not provide good quality steering wheels.
- the document GB-A-949 110 describes a badminton shuttlecock with several poles and a single peripheral iodine.
- the invention proposes to remedy these various disadvantages.
- a badminton shuttlecock including a cap, and a skirt formed of several feathers, each feather comprising a shaft and two blades, where each feather is formed of a natural shaft, and blades artificial.
- the artificial blades are made of a nonwoven of polyester, polypropylene or glass fibers.
- the invention also relates to a method of manufacturing the steering wheel as defined above, in which a natural shaft is taken from an animal, the artificial blades are made separately and the artificial blades are reported on this natural shaft. , so as to form the constituent feathers of the skirt of the steering wheel.
- the blades are reported on the shaft by gluing.
- the figure 1 illustrates a badminton steering wheel, which conventionally comprises a cap 2, from which extends a skirt 4, which is formed of different feathers 10, connected to each other in the usual manner by a strapping 6.
- the figure 2 illustrates more precisely a feather 10, which comprises a shaft 12 and two blades 14, extending on either side of this shaft, in a manner almost symmetrical.
- these two blades 14 are made in one piece. However, as a variant not shown, they can be separated from each other.
- each pen 10 firstly uses a natural shaft 12, namely taken from an animal, such as a goose. Separately, by any suitable method, the two blades 14 are produced separately. These are artificial, ie they consist of a non-natural material, which is for example a polyester nonwoven. The artificial blades thus produced are reported on the natural shaft, according to the arrow F at the figure 3 by any appropriate means, especially by gluing.
- the steering wheel according to the invention comprising a natural shaft and artificial blades, represents a satisfactory compromise between existing solutions.
- the steering wheel according to the invention has a quality significantly higher than that of artificial wheels, made in the prior art.
- the steering wheel of the invention comprises feathers separated from each other, so that it has a global shape similar to that of flying feathers all natural. This is to be compared with the artificial ruffles of the state of the art, which use a synthetic skirt in one piece, whose characteristics are very different from those of all-natural feather flounces.

Claims (4)
- A Shuttlecock comprising a cork (2) and a skirt (4) formed by a plurality of feathers (10), each feather comprising a shaft (12) and two vanes (14), where each feather (10) is formed from a natural shaft (12) and artificial vanes (14).
- A Shuttlecock according to claim 1, characterized in that the artificial vanes are made of non-woven fabric made of polyester, polypropylene, or glass fibers.
- A method of manufacturing the shuttlecock according to either preceding claim, wherein a natural shaft (12) is taken from an animal, the artificial vanes (14) are made separately, and the artificial vanes are fitted to said natural shaft, so as to form the feathers constituting the skirt of the shuttlecock.
- A method according to claim 3, characterized in that the vanes are fitted to the shaft by adhesive.
